Behind The Lens
Location
South Lake Tahoe CaliforniaTime
sunset time in mid March of this yearLighting
natural lightEquipment
camera Canon t6i, lens canon 70-300mm @100mm, tripod SLIK Pro 500HD with INDURO AKB2/BH2 ball headInspiration
Lake tahoe is a beautiful place to take photos in winter so all I had to do was find the area that grab my attention and then wait for the sunset to arrive, as most of my work is doing panormas I dont have any limitations with what I can see through my lenses, in this case I took around 70 photos with my 70-300mm lens all 70+ photos at the 100mm markEditing
I use windows Image Composite Editor(to stitch the photos together), then photoshop to correct any problems and finally lightroom( I may change the order of the programs depending of what im looking in my panoramasIn my camera bag
my Cameras Canon t4i and t6i; canon Lenses EFS 10-18 f/4.5-5.6, EFS 18-55 f/3.5-5.6 & EF 70-300 f/4-5.6; 2 flash lights, bottle of water and paper spray(just in case)Feedback
dont let the limitations of the lens limit your view thats the beauty of doing panoramas you can make them as big or as small as you want, always take more photos then what you think you need and have fun taking the photos
